Why is it important to maintain backplate/harness alignment?

Explanation:
Maintaining backplate and harness alignment keeps the SCBA weight centered on your body. When the backplate sits flat against your upper back and the shoulder straps and waist belt are evenly tensioned, the load is transferred mainly to the hips rather than the shoulders. This balanced loading improves stability, reduces fatigue in the shoulders and back, and lowers the risk of pressure points and injury during long operations or when making dynamic moves like climbing, crawling, or dragging. If alignment is off, the unit can tilt, straps can bite or twist, and the load shifts to one area, causing quicker exhaustion, reduced mobility, and potential discomfort or injury. This also makes controlling movement harder and can interfere with quick, safe donning and doffing when time is critical. So proper alignment directly supports safety, comfort, and performance in the field.
